- Cleveland’s ninth-place hitter delivered a two-run homer in the eighth after Bo Naylor reached, overturning a 2-1 deficit.
- The victory put the Guardians at 75-71 and kept them second in the AL Central as FanGraphs still pegs their wild-card odds under 10 percent.
- Gavin Williams worked six innings with six strikeouts and four hits allowed, with Matt Festa credited with the win and Cade Smith securing the save.
- Manager Stephen Vogt called it a dream scenario for a young player and said the swing could help Kayfus regain his timing.
- Kayfus had struggled since his August call-up, entering with a .196 average and .634 OPS, with Chicago visiting next for a home series.
